    Great review. What about comfort pro vs freestyle rocker?

    • @hairry7899
      @hairry7899  2 года назад +6

      The Freestyle is an awesome chair and is great for when you need to sit forward like up to a table, or playing games but also gives you the ability to rock back. I would say the comfort pro is more comfortable but the Freestyle might be more useful in different situations. If you have back problems or have difficulty getting up or down then I would go with the Freestyle. I l'll start working on a video comparison. Thanks for your comment 👍

    Thanks for the reviews. How easy/hard is it to fix the hydraulic pumps if it ever breaks?

    • @hairry7899
      @hairry7899  2 года назад +2

      Thanks for the review! They are a spring strut so there is no fluid. They have a lifetime warranty which covers the struts so if they brake you can get a replacement chair, however we've sold these chairs for several years and never had one come back due to a bad strut. I have never taken one apart so I'm not sure how difficult it is to fix them and I don't think Gci actually sales replacement parts. Hope this helps!
